As a tenant in Spain understanding the timelines for security deposit returns is key to protecting your money and your rights The law sets rules on when the deposit must be returned and Under Article 36 4 of Spain s Urban Leases Law LAU landlords have one month from the day you hand over the keys to return your deposit If they don t they re legally required to pay
